Volleyball splits two on Sat., goes 2-2 in Texas
9/17/2011 12:00:00 AM | Volleyball
The No. 7-ranked Tommies volleyball team split two Saturday matches and finished 2-2 on the weekend at the Trinity University tourney in San Antonio.
UST (11-2) lost 3-0 to No. 8-ranked Carthage, but came back to post a five-game win over Occidental, which received votes but sits just out of the national rankings. The Toms won 15-11 in the decisive fifth game and ended Oxy's seven-match win streak.
Carthage (11-2) went 4-0 to claim the championship.
In Friday's opening round, the Toms lost in five to No. 10-ranked Southwestern, but scored a 3-0 win over No. 23-ranked Trinity.
Freshman Kelly Foley had 24 kills in the five-game win over Oxy and hit .310 with 69 kills in 16 games on the tournament. Jill Greenfield had 19 digs and 15 kills against Oxy. Kaitlain Wachter had 67 digs on the 16 games in the tourney.
The Tommies are home Wednesday to face Carleton (7 p.m.).
